Output 983edf80fb81842eb1ea0c118c76e5af40fccb6bc7acad8e80bf4571670477fc:63

value
38301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c309d4bb9b8da82b7c92cf79472c75e92f047fcb OP_EQUAL
address
3KUHU26UAkSxHRWKAyPqPZtrR2kB5iiBJR
transaction
983edf80fb81842eb1ea0c118c76e5af40fccb6bc7acad8e80bf4571670477fc
spent
true